Protecting Your Server with Nginx HTTPS Implementation

Nginx serves as a robust and versatile web server platform widely deployed for its efficiency and scalability. To enhance the security of your website hosted on Nginx, enabling HTTPS is paramount. HTTPS encrypts the communication between your users' browsers and your server, safeguarding sensitive information such as login credentials and payment details.

Achieving this crucial feature involves configuring SSL/TLS certificates within your Nginx setup. You can acquire a certificate from a trusted Certificate Authority (CA) or utilize self-signed certificates for development environments. Once you possess the necessary certificate files, integrating them into your Nginx configuration file is essential.

Within the settings file, locate the relevant section for SSL/TLS and specify the paths to your certificate and private key files. Ensure that your server listens on port 443, which is the standard port for HTTPS traffic. After configuring these settings, restart Nginx for the changes to take effect.

Validating your HTTPS configuration can be accomplished using online tools such as SSL Labs or Qualys SSL Labs, which provide detailed reports on the strength and security posture of your implemented protocol.
